Harvard Men in the Harriers Athletic Meeting.

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

The following Harvard men will compete in the Salford Harriers Athletic meeting this afternoon:

220 yds. hurdle: F. Allen, W. Hoag, A. H. Green.

440 yds. run (open): G. L. Batchelder, S. V. R. Crosby, S. V. R. Thayer, F. Allen, K. Brown, T. J. stead, J. R. Jenkins, W. L. Thompson, V. S. Rothschild, F. C. Stetson, E. S. Mullins.

220 yds. dash: S. V. R. Crosby, S. V. R. Thayer, F. Allen, S. Wells, Jr., K. Brown, M. Nelson, G. S. Whiteside, P. S. Johnson, F. A. Baker, W. H. Gratwick, Jr., J. R. Jenkins, A. H. Green, W. H. Maynard, W. L. Thompson, V. S. Rothschild, E. S. Mullins, E. Kent, J. S. Cook, O. K. Hawes.

100 yds. dash; S. V. R. Crosby, L. C. Page, S. V. R. Thayer, F. Allen, M. Nelson, J. O. Powers, P. S. Johnson, F. A. Baker, J. Hale, Jr., G. F. Brown, Jr., A. H. Green, W. L. Thompson, E. S. Mullins, E. kent, J. S. Cook, O. K. Hawes.

880 yds. run: G. L. Batchelder, S. V. R. Thayer, K. Brown, G. Lowell, C. H. Page, W. B. Cohen, T. P. King, T. E. Stetson, H. F. Hollis.

440 yds. run (novice): S. Wells, Jr., C. H. Bean, C. H. Page, F. A. Baker, W. H. Gratwick, Jr., H. M. Wheelwright, J. R. Corbin, W. H. Maynard, E. S. Mullins, E. Kent, H. F. Hollis.

2 mile steeplechase: F. Allen.

1 mile walk: C. R. Bardeen, R. S. Hale, J. H. Bell, A. L. Endicott.

Putting the shot: W. H. Shea, A. H. Green.

Running broad jump: O. W. Shead, J. Powers, E. B. Bloss, J. Hale, Jr., W. Hoag, A. H. Green.

Pole vault: H. M. Wheelwright, A. H. Green.

One mile run: G. Collamore, G. Lowell, C. H. Page, W. B. Cohen, T. P. King.

The inspectors are P. Manchester, J. H. Rhoades, J. Mandell and T. C. Smith, all of Harvard. Mr. Lathrop is one of the timers.
